Multidimensional state of the north-central Peruvian anchovy stock

Published:

Scientific question

How has the multidimensional state of the north-central Peruvian anchovy stock changed in response to natural variability and fishing pressure within the Humboldt Current System?

Study system

The project focuses on the north-central stock of Peruvian anchovy (Engraulis ringens), a short-lived small pelagic fish that supports one of the world’s largest fisheries and responds rapidly to environmental variability.

Data

The analytical framework integrates acoustic surveys, fishery-dependent observations, biological sampling, demographic information, and environmental data from oceanographic and satellite sources.

Methods

  • Multidimensional stock-state indicators.
  • Dimension-specific indicator selection and multivariate integration.
  • Trend, breakpoint, regime-shift, and threshold analysis.
  • Pressure–state relationships involving environmental and fishing variables.
  • Spatio-temporal analysis of abundance, distribution, and habitat conditions.
